首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

由于找不到满足setuptools>=40.8要求的版本,apache beam 2.19.0不再在云数据流上运行

由于找不到满足setuptools>=40.8要求的版本,Apache Beam 2.19.0不再在云数据流上运行。

Apache Beam是一个开源的分布式数据处理框架,它提供了一种统一的编程模型,用于批处理和流处理数据,并可以在各种批处理和流处理引擎上运行。它的目标是提供一个简单、可扩展和高效的方式来处理大规模数据集。

在云计算领域,Apache Beam可以用于构建和管理大规模数据处理流水线,实现数据的提取、转换和加载。它的优势包括:

  1. 统一的编程模型:Apache Beam提供了一种统一的编程模型,使开发人员可以使用相同的代码逻辑来处理批处理和流处理数据。这样可以减少开发和维护成本,并提高代码的可复用性。
  2. 可扩展性:Apache Beam可以在各种批处理和流处理引擎上运行,包括Apache Flink、Apache Spark、Google Cloud Dataflow等。这使得它可以根据数据处理的需求选择最适合的引擎,并实现水平扩展以处理大规模数据集。
  3. 高效性:Apache Beam通过优化数据处理流水线的执行计划和并行化处理任务,提供了高效的数据处理能力。它还支持窗口化处理和延迟处理等特性,以满足实时数据处理的需求。
  4. 生态系统支持:Apache Beam拥有活跃的开源社区,提供了丰富的扩展库和工具,以支持各种数据处理场景。开发人员可以利用这些资源来加速开发过程,并实现更复杂的数据处理逻辑。

对于解决"由于找不到满足setuptools>=40.8要求的版本,Apache Beam 2.19.0不再在云数据流上运行"的问题,可以考虑以下解决方案:

  1. 更新setuptools版本:尝试更新setuptools到满足要求的版本,以使Apache Beam 2.19.0能够在云数据流上运行。可以使用pip工具来更新setuptools,例如运行命令pip install --upgrade setuptools
  2. 降低Apache Beam版本:如果更新setuptools版本不可行,可以考虑降低Apache Beam的版本,以找到满足要求的setuptools版本。可以通过指定版本号来安装较旧的Apache Beam版本,例如运行命令pip install apache-beam==2.18.0
  3. 寻找替代解决方案:如果无法解决setuptools版本的问题,可以考虑寻找其他类似的数据处理框架或工具,以满足在云数据流上运行的需求。可以参考腾讯云的相关产品和服务,如腾讯云数据开发平台(链接地址:https://cloud.tencent.com/product/dp)来寻找合适的解决方案。

需要注意的是,以上解决方案仅供参考,具体的解决方法可能因实际情况而异。建议在实施之前仔细阅读相关文档和参考资料,并根据具体需求进行调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• InfoWorld Bossie Awards公布

    AI 前线导读: 一年一度由世界知名科技媒体 InfoWorld 评选的 Bossie Awards 于 9 月 26 日公布,本次 Bossie Awards 评选出了最佳数据库与数据分析平台奖、最佳软件开发工具奖、最佳机器学习项目奖等多个奖项。在最佳开源数据库与数据分析平台奖中,Spark 和 Beam 再次入选,连续两年入选的 Kafka 这次意外滑铁卢,取而代之的是新兴项目 Pulsar;这次开源数据库入选的还有 PingCAP 的 TiDB;另外Neo4依然是图数据库领域的老大,但其开源版本只能单机无法部署分布式,企业版又费用昂贵的硬伤,使很多初入图库领域的企业望而却步,一直走低调务实作风的OrientDB已经慢慢成为更多用户的首选。附:30分钟入门图数据库(精编版) Bossie Awards 是知名英文科技媒体 InfoWorld 针对开源软件颁发的年度奖项,根据这些软件对开源界的贡献,以及在业界的影响力评判获奖对象,由 InfoWorld 编辑独立评选,目前已经持续超过十年,是 IT 届最具影响力和含金量奖项之一。 一起来看看接下来你需要了解和学习的数据库和数据分析工具有哪些。

    04
    领券